Detailed Summary

Colorectal cancer (CRC) is the second leading cause of cancer-related deaths in the United States. Results from randomized clinical trials and intervention studies have suggested that implementation of a CRC screening program for men and women over age 50 results in reduced CRC mortality. However, for this reduction to be fully realized, it is imperative that all positive screening tests are followed by complete diagnostic evaluation (CDE). Numerous intervention programs have been used to improve initial CRC screening rates, but data indicate that outside the research setting, less than half of patients with a positive fecal occult blood test (FOBT) screening result undergo CDE. To enhance the translation of this best practice recommendation to clinical practice, the investigators propose to implement an electronic event notification intervention (CRC-ENS) directed at making physician and system level changes to increase the proportion of patients with an abnormal FOBT that undergo CDE.

Interventions

Electronic Consult Systemdevice

Consult system is an event notification system programmed to function within the VA electronic medical record system.
